Trekking into the forest of the oldest national park in Africa. It’s older than Virunga National Park (1925), older than the Hluhluwe Imfolozi Game Reserve in South Africa, established in 1895. It dates back to the reign of Emperor Zera Yacob, from 1434 to 1468, when he first designated it as a "crown forest."
